Hi, I have a Mercedes A170CDi Auto that has gone into limp-mode on the gearbox. I have had a diagnostics check done and it shows a P1841 Current fault code which is a Solenoid Valve Y3/7y2 3 shift fault....

The code is consistent with an electrical short within the shift motor solenoid. These solenoids open and close fluid passageways within the gearbox that cause clutches engage and disengage with the planetary gear system that make up an automatic gear box. Auto boxes are very involved pieces of machinery and best left to experts so I am afraid it needs a trip to the Mercedes dealership or a good auto transmission depot. It could be that the gear box can be easily renovated by fitting a new solenoid in which case an overhaul rather than replacement will be the cheaper option. Since you have the code for the fault I would phone around for repair quotes.
